£477K NERC Award

Dr P Pomeroy, Sea Mammal Research Unit has received funding from NERC (£477K) and the Esmée Fairburn Foundation (£49K) to examine how seal populations are changing around the UK. New software will be developed allowing digital comparison of natural markings on seals to extend existing capture-mark-recapture studies with CREEM, St Andrews. Working with Lex Hiby, Conservation Research and Dr S Twiss, University of Durham, thousands of images collected during long term seal studies will be included for analysis. Provision of this expertise across a network of users will make the group an international focus for such work.
